What is Panel Upgrading?
Electrical panel updating includes changing an older electrical service panel with a brand-new one that adheres to modern requirements and requirements. The upgrade generally addresses concerns such as insufficient power capability, out-of-date circuit breakers, and security threats.
Why Upgrade Your Electrical Panel?
Upgrading an electrical panel is not simply a matter of visual appeals; it has several essential benefits, consisting of:

Increased Power Capacity: Older panels frequently have lower amperage rankings, which can be insufficient for powering modern-day appliances and devices. Upgrading to a panel with increased capacity (such as 200 amps) makes sure that you can fulfill your present and future energy requirements.

Boosted Safety: Old electrical panels can pose considerable security threats, consisting of fire threats and electrical shocks. New UPVC Door Panels come equipped with security features, consisting of rise protection and modern breaker that can avoid overloads.

Improved Energy Efficiency: Upgrading an electrical panel can cause more effective energy usage. Modern panels permit for much better circulation of electrical load, which can lower waste and lower utility bills.

Compliance with Current Codes: Electrical codes progress to guarantee security and efficiency. Upgrading your panel guarantees that your electrical system abides by the current policies, reducing the danger of legal issues and improving home value.

Increased Home Value: An upgraded electrical panel can considerably increase the resale worth of a property. Potential purchasers are frequently more inclined to purchase homes that have modern, robust electrical systems.
The Panel Upgrading Process
Updating an electrical panel is a task best delegated licensed electrical contractors due to the intricacies involved. The process normally consists of the following actions:
1. Assessment
The initial step involves a thorough assessment of the current electrical system. An electrical expert will examine the existing panel, wiring, and electrical load requirements to determine what type of upgrade is necessary.
2. Planning
When the assessment is total, the electrician will develop a plan that lays out the specs for the new panel, consisting of the amperage, variety of circuits, and any extra parts needed.
3. Obtaining Permits
Many jurisdictions require permits for electrical work. The licensed electrical expert will manage these authorizations to ensure that all work is compliant with local codes.
4. Setup
During installation, the electrical contractor will:
Disconnect power to the existing panel.Remove the old panel and any out-of-date wiring.Install the brand-new panel and link it to the existing electrical system.Test the brand-new system for functionality and security.5. Evaluation
After setup, the work will typically be checked by a regional structure authority to make sure compliance with codes and security requirements.
Key Considerations When Upgrading an Electrical Panel
When thinking about an electrical panel upgrade, it's important to keep the following consider mind:

Amperage Needs: Determine the amperage required based on your family or business's energy intake. Typical standards are 100, 150, and 200 amps.

Future Upgrades: Consider how your energy requirements may change gradually. If you prepare to include high-energy appliances or systems, it's smart to update to a larger panel now.

Place: Ensure the new panel is installed in a place that satisfies security requirements and is easily accessible for upkeep.

Expert Help: Always hire a certified electrician for panel upgrades to make sure the work is performed safely and properly.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)FAQ 1: How frequently should I update my electrical panel?
It's advisable to consider an upgrade if your home is over 30 years old, you're adding significant new appliances, or you're experiencing regular breaker tripping.
FAQ 2: What are the indications that I require to upgrade my electrical panel?
Indications consist of flickering lights, regular breaker journeys, a burning smell from the panel, rust on the panel, or the presence of a fuse box.
FAQ 3: How much does it cost to upgrade an electrical panel?
Costs can differ widely depending upon location, the complexity of the job, and the amperage needed, however homeowners can expect to pay anywhere from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 3,000 for a panel upgrade.
FAQ 4: Will I need to update my wiring also?
It depends on the condition of the existing wiring and the capacity of the new panel. An electrical contractor will recommend whether your present electrical wiring can manage the increased load.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 5: Can I upgrade my panel myself?
No, it is not recommended. Updating an electrical panel includes substantial risks, including the danger of electrical shock or fire. Always hire a certified professional.
